  1. Local Forges
    In my district there are some forges and the nearest one to my house is owned by a man named Walsh. Mr. Walsh who is now the smith learned the trade from his father. This forge is built beside the Killala road and is very convenient to people. The walls of the forge are build with stone and roofed with tin with one door and window.
